Subject: CVS commit: pkgsrc/devel/dconf
From: Patrick Welche
Date: 2022-03-02 14:17:25
Message id: 20220302131725.D22CBFB24@cvs.NetBSD.org

Log Message:
Update dconf to 0.40.0

XXX Please check on illumos:

The patches for illumos as per

https://gitlab.gnome.org/GNOME/dconf/issues/49

no longer apply. It is not obvious to me whether or not they are still
necessary given the new use of symbol files.
(Patch author contacted a week ago.)

Changes in dconf 0.40.0
=======================

 - common: Add missing G_BEGIN/END_DECLS to allow use of headers from C++
   code (Philip Withnall, !67)

Changes in dconf 0.39.1
=======================

 - build: improve libdconf visible symbols (Inigo Martinez, Daniel Playfair
   Cal, !59)
 - engine: do not emit optimistic change notifications unless the local value
   is different (Daniel Playfair Cal, !2)
 - build: minor fixes to bash completion script (Philip Withnall, !64)
 - service: add a systemd unit for D-Bus activation (Simon McVittie, !63)

Changes in dconf 0.38.0
=======================

 - build: Install bash-completion relative to datadir (Jan Trojnar, !58)
 - client: add `dconf compile` to shell autocomplete (Andreas Polnas, !60)

Files:
RevisionActionfile
1.66modifypkgsrc/devel/dconf/Makefile
1.12modifypkgsrc/devel/dconf/PLIST
1.22modifypkgsrc/devel/dconf/distinfo
1.1removepkgsrc/devel/dconf/patches/patch-client_meson.build
1.1removepkgsrc/devel/dconf/patches/patch-gsettings_meson.build